Output 8b566bf3a8d8459948794c8f4c3bb76dba7da0281d2af08618ea43cd37d3b1b6:0

value
1704232
script pubkey
OP_0 OP_PUSHBYTES_20 0d0707ae7ca8cf3466dba368fa2bb378f2b6e529
address
bc1qp5rs0tnu4r8ngekm5d5052an0retdeffwqd5qc
transaction
8b566bf3a8d8459948794c8f4c3bb76dba7da0281d2af08618ea43cd37d3b1b6